Description
Beat-'em-up featuring Chip and Dale recovering boxes to throw at enemies in Fat Cat's lair. Published by Capcom, released in Europe in 1990. Chip and Dale playable in simultaneous two-player co-op, boxes to throw, Disney anime levels and creative bosses. A Capcom Disney masterpiece on NES.

Collector interest

The Capcom adaptation of the Disney cartoon in its European PAL NES form. A late release with a short print, especially in the original cardboard box, turns it into a prime target for Capcom Disney collectors alongside 'DuckTales' and 'Darkwing Duck'. PAL CIB in clean shape climbs steadily, lifted by the renewed acclaim of the Capcom Disney run via the Afterlife compilation and Cartoon Network reruns.

Is Chip 'n Dale - Rescue Rangers still worth playing in 2026?

Chip 'n Dale - Rescue Rangers, also known in Japan as Chip to Dale no Daisakusen, is one of the loveliest Disney games on NES. Capcom delivers an exemplary cooperative action platformer: varied levels, adorable animation, perfect pacing and precise controls. The local two-player mode turns the experience into pure recreation. The difficulty stays accessible without ever feeling bland, and the charming soundtrack carries the journey. Still a classic to bring out without hesitation today.
